Team Goemkarponn KULEM: A 32-year-old man from Vasco drowned in a water body at Kulem while on an outing with friends. The deceased, identified as Anand Belegal, a resident of Shantinagar, had reportedly gone to the site with three friends when he went missing under mysterious circumstances. Search operations were launched soon after his disappearance was reported. His body was recovered on Friday morning. Sources informed that a post-mortem examination is being conducted at the Margao Hospital to ascertain the exact cause of death. Local authorities are investigating the incident.

Team Goemkarponn OLD GOA: Old Goa Police have filed an FIR following a complaint made by Deepa Chauhan, a resident of Carambolim. In her report, she alleges that her husband, Hitesh Chauhan, stole her purse, which contained a mobile phone, ATM cards, cash, jewelry, and a wristwatch. The theft reportedly occurred at their residence. The police are currently investigating the incident, and further updates will be provided as the investigation progresses.
Team Goemkarponn SANGUEM: A devastating fire caused by an LPG cylinder blast completely destroyed a hut in Velipwada, Bhatim, Sanguem, late last night. The hut owner, Shrimati Gaonkar, and her young daughter had a narrow escape as they were at a neighbor’s house when the fire broke out. Unfortunately, the blaze destroyed all their household belongings, including a cupboard, cash, and valuable gold jewellery. The fire has left the family homeless. Local authorities have begun an investigation to determine the cause of the LPG cylinder explosion and are offering support to the affected family during this difficult time.
